BlockchainTransactionData (卡尔达诺)

BlockchainTransactionData[txid]

提供有关卡尔达诺区块链上 ID 为 txid 的区块链交易的信息.

BlockchainTransactionData[txid,prop]

给出交易的指定属性.

更多信息

  • BlockchainTransactionData 返回与卡尔达诺交易 ID 关联的交易列表.
  • 属性包括:
  • "TransactionID"交易 ID
    "BlockHash"包含该交易的区块的哈希
    "BlockNumber"包含该交易的区块的高度
    "Confirmations"确认该区块包含该交易的区块
    "BlockIndex"区块内交易索引
    "Timestamp"交易的时间戳
    "TotalOutput"交易类型
    "Fee"为该交易支付的费用
    "Deposit"用于权益密钥和矿池注册的 ada 押金
    "ByteCount"以字节为单位的交易大小
    "InvalidHereafter"必须提交交易的插槽数
    "InvalidBefore"交易有效的插槽数
    "Metadata"此交易的元数据
    "Mint"该交易中铸造的令牌
    "Withdrawals"本次交易中的提款
    "Inputs"交易输入数据
    "Outputs"交易输出数据
    "ReferenceInputs"交易参考输入数据
    "CollateralInputs"交易抵押输入数据
    "CollateralOutputs"交易抵押输出数据
    "Scripts"此交易包含的脚本
  • "Metadata" 的值是从链上 JSON 对象创建的关联.
  • "Mint" 的值是与以下密钥的关联列表:
  • "AssetID"令牌的资产 ID(与资产名称连接的策略 ID)
    "AssetName"令牌的资产名称
    "PolicyID"令牌策略 ID
    "Fingerprint"编码令牌资产 ID
    "Quantity"本次交易中铸造的令牌数量
  • "Inputs" 的值是与以下密钥的关联列表:
  • "TransactionID"源交易哈希
    "Index"源交易输出中的索引
    "Amount"源数量
    "Address"源地址
    "Tokens"源令牌
    "Redeemer"用于花费源交易输出的赎回者
    "ScriptHash"源交易输出处脚本的哈希值
  • "ReferenceInputs""CollateralInputs" 中的关联与 "Inputs" 中的关联具有相同的结构.
  • "Outputs" 的值是与以下密钥的关联列表:
  • "Index"输出索引
    "Amount"转移数量
    "Address"目的地址
    "Tokens"转移令牌
    "Datum"源交易输出的脚本数据
    "DatumHash"源交易输出处的数据哈希
    "ReferenceScript"源交易输出处的参考脚本
  • "CollateralOutputs" 中的关联具有与 "Outputs" 中的关联具有相同的结构.
  • "Scripts" 的值是具有以下键的关联列表:
  • "Hash"脚本的哈希值
    "Type"脚本类型
    "Size"脚本大小
  • BlockchainTransactionData 可访问 Cardano mainnet(默认)和 testnet "preprod",该网络是一个新网络,用来进行测试. 想要指定这些网络,可以使用 BlockchainBase 选项.

范例

打开所有单元关闭所有单元

基本范例  (4)

从卡尔达诺区块链获取有关交易的信息:

通过提供交易 ID 列表从多个卡尔达诺交易中获取数据:

获取交易中包含的总输出:

从卡尔达诺交易中获取多个属性:

范围  (21)

BlockHash  (1)

获取包含卡尔达诺交易的区块的哈希值:

BlockIndex  (1)

获取包含卡尔达诺交易的块的索引:

BlockNumber  (1)

获取包含卡尔达诺交易的区块高度:

ByteCount  (1)

获取卡尔达诺交易的字节数:

Confirmations  (1)

获取包含卡尔达诺交易的区块的确认信息:

CollateralInputs  (1)

CollateralOutputs  (1)

Deposit  (1)

获取卡尔达诺交易的存款金额:

Fee  (1)

获取卡尔达诺交易中包含的费用:

Inputs  (1)

获取卡尔达诺交易的输入:

InvalidBefore  (1)

获取交易有效的插槽数:

InvalidHereafter  (1)

获取交易必须提交的插槽数:

Metadata  (1)

获取卡尔达诺交易的元数据:

将结果导出为原始的链上 JSON 对象:

Mint  (1)

获取卡尔达诺交易的铸币信息:

Outputs  (1)

获得卡尔达诺交易的输出:

ReferenceInputs  (1)

获取卡尔达诺交易的参考输入:

Scripts  (1)

获取卡尔达诺交易中使用的脚本:

Timestamp  (1)

获得卡尔达诺交易的时间戳:

TotalOutput  (1)

获得卡尔达诺交易的总输出:

TransactionID  (1)

获取与提供的交易 ID 匹配的交易 ID:

Withdrawals  (1)

获取通过卡尔达诺交易提取的金额:

选项  (2)

BlockchainBase  (2)

主网  (1)

从卡尔达诺主网交易获取信息:

测试网  (1)

从卡尔达诺测试网交易获取信息:

应用  (1)

获取有关在卡尔达诺区块链上铸造的 NFT 的信息:

提取元数据:

获取与 NFT 文件关联的 IPFS CID:

使用 ExternalStorageDownload 从 IPFS 下载文件:

导入文件:

可能存在的问题  (2)

不存在的哈希  (1)

在一个区块链中使用来自另一个区块链的交易 ID 将返回 Missing 输出:

不正确的哈希  (1)

提供无效的交易 ID 将返回 $Failed 输出:

Wolfram Research (2021),BlockchainTransactionData,Wolfram 语言函数,https://reference.wolfram.com/language/ref/blockchain/BlockchainTransactionData-Cardano.html.

文本

Wolfram Research (2021),BlockchainTransactionData,Wolfram 语言函数,https://reference.wolfram.com/language/ref/blockchain/BlockchainTransactionData-Cardano.html.

CMS

Wolfram 语言. 2021. "BlockchainTransactionData." Wolfram 语言与系统参考资料中心. Wolfram Research. https://reference.wolfram.com/language/ref/blockchain/BlockchainTransactionData-Cardano.html.

APA

Wolfram 语言. (2021). BlockchainTransactionData. Wolfram 语言与系统参考资料中心. 追溯自 https://reference.wolfram.com/language/ref/blockchain/BlockchainTransactionData-Cardano.html 年

BibTeX

@misc{reference.wolfram_2024_blockchaintransactiondata, author="Wolfram Research", title="{BlockchainTransactionData}", year="2021", howpublished="\url{https://reference.wolfram.com/language/ref/blockchain/BlockchainTransactionData-Cardano.html}", note=[Accessed: 21-November-2024 ]}

BibLaTeX

@online{reference.wolfram_2024_blockchaintransactiondata, organization={Wolfram Research}, title={BlockchainTransactionData}, year={2021}, url={https://reference.wolfram.com/language/ref/blockchain/BlockchainTransactionData-Cardano.html}, note=[Accessed: 21-November-2024 ]}